Verdict All in all, Sri Ganapathi Mess’s was a super satisfying lunch and we trust you will most likely leave with a stuffed and happy tummy. At least our friends over Chasing A Plate felt that way. Prices here are slightly above the average banana leaf eatery but the taste of their food totally made up for it.
Rice + 4 Vegetables + Papadum, 6 ringgit, Chicken Varuval, 8 ringgit, Sura Puttu, 6 ringgit, Fish Cutlet, 5 ringgit = 25 ringgit. Loved every single ingredient on the leaf. Yum! The vegetable option for the day was spinach, cucumber, bittergourd and brinjal. Delicious. The chicken curry was da bomb. Spicy and thick, flavorful, guaranteed to tickle your tastebuds with every single mouth you take. The meats was awesome as well. Couldnt have asked for a better wholesome Indian lunch.
This is a famous banana leaf rice place that I did not know about so my friends took me there for lunch one day. True enough, it was very tasty with very crispy deep fried squid which is a must-order. We shared the meat dishes such as curry mutton, deep fried fish and chicken. I tried the crab rasam and just find it spicy though my friend said it tastes like tom yum to her
The highlight of our meal was the fried sotong. It was deep fried to crispy perfection, along with curry leaves and onions. It arrived piping hot as it is fried to order.
